Would this be considered blind fire in your fields? by TidySalt in airsoft

[–]freakierice 1 point2 points Ā (0 children)

Site I used to play had the simple rule of, front rear eye.
If your gun is not lined up in such a way that the front, rear of the gun and your eye line are in line it’s considered blind firing.
This was mainly to prevent people from hip or over head firing like you see here. But then again we don’t all run paintball masks, so the chances of a shot getting behind shooting glasses was a lot higher and it also forced to to look at your target to ensure they were actually a target and not some random who’s walked onto site

Petrol by Downtown-Building-70 in drivingUK

[–]freakierice 4 points5 points Ā (0 children)

The only difference between fuel at garage a compared to garage b is the additive package that garage selects (or doesn’t)
Other than that the fuel has to meet a minimum legal standard, and if it falls below that then the garage and supplier are liable for any damage caused to vehicles they sell it too…

The additives can be better at some garages than others but generally they only put them in the ā€œpremiumā€ fuels, and you can buy them off the shelf if your that interested.
